.wishlist-page{display:block;padding-top:calc(var(--section-gap, 40) * 1px);padding-bottom:calc(var(--section-gap, 40) * 1px);min-height:70vh}.wishlist-grid-item{position:relative;transition:opacity .3s ease,transform .3s ease}.wishlist-shared-banner{background:#f6f2ea;border-radius:10px;padding:16px 20px;margin-bottom:24px;display:flex;align-items:center;justify-content:space-between;gap:16px;flex-wrap:wrap}.wishlist-shared-banner__info{display:flex;align-items:center;gap:8px;color:#1c3405;font-size:15px;line-height:1.4}.wishlist-shared-banner__info svg{flex-shrink:0;color:#1c3405}.wishlist-shared-banner__btn{display:inline-flex;align-items:center;gap:6px;flex-shrink:0;background:#1c3405;color:#f6f2ea;border:none;border-radius:8px;padding:10px 18px;font-size:14px;font-weight:600;cursor:pointer;white-space:nowrap;transition:background-color .15s ease}.wishlist-shared-banner__btn:hover{background:#162a04}.wishlist-shared-banner__btn--done{background:#2a5a14;cursor:default}.wishlist-shared-banner__done{color:#1c3405;font-weight:600;font-size:14px}.wishlist-empty__link{display:inline-block;padding:12px 28px;background:#1c3405;color:#fff;text-decoration:none;border-radius:var(--btn-border-radius, 4px);font-weight:700;transition:background-color .2s ease}.wishlist-empty__link:hover{background:#2a4e0a}wishlist-button{margin-left:auto;align-self:flex-start;margin-top:-2px;z-index:8}.product-block-media,.product-block-info{position:relative}.wishlist-btn--pdp{position:absolute;top:12px;right:12px;z-index:10}.wishlist-btn--pdp .wishlist-btn__toggle{background:#ffffffe6;border:1px solid rgba(0,0,0,.12);width:38px;height:38px}.wishlist-btn--pdp .wishlist-btn__icon{width:20px;height:20px;stroke-width:1.5}.wishlist-btn__toggle{display:flex;align-items:center;justify-content:center;width:28px;height:28px;padding:0;border:none;border-radius:50%;background:transparent;cursor:pointer;transition:transform .2s ease;color:#1a1a1a}.wishlist-btn__toggle:hover{transform:scale(1.1)}.wishlist-btn__toggle:active{transform:scale(.95)}.wishlist-btn__icon{width:25px;height:25px;transition:opacity .15s ease,transform .2s ease;pointer-events:none}.wishlist-btn__icon--outline{display:block}.wishlist-btn__icon--filled{display:none;color:rgb(var(--btn-bg-color))}wishlist-button.is-active .wishlist-btn__icon--outline{display:none}wishlist-button.is-active .wishlist-btn__icon--filled{display:block}wishlist-button.is-animating .wishlist-btn__toggle{animation:wishlist-pop .4s ease}@keyframes wishlist-pop{0%{transform:scale(1)}30%{transform:scale(1.3)}60%{transform:scale(.9)}to{transform:scale(1)}}.header__icon--wishlist{display:flex;flex-direction:column;align-items:center;width:auto;min-width:44px}.header__icon svg{transition:transform .2s ease;will-change:transform}.header__icon:hover svg{transform:scale(1.1)}.wishlist-count-bubble{position:absolute;top:0;right:-6px;min-width:18px;height:18px;padding:0 5px;border-radius:9px;background:rgb(var(--btn-bg-color));color:#fff;font-size:11px;font-weight:600;line-height:18px;text-align:center;pointer-events:none}.wishlist-page{padding:calc(var(--section-gap) * 1px) 0}@media(min-width:769px){.wishlist-page{padding:calc(var(--section-gap) * 1px) 0}}.wishlist-page__header{display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:16px;margin-bottom:32px}.wishlist-page__title{margin:0}.wishlist-page__count{color:rgba(var(--text-color),.6);font-size:.9em}.wishlist-page__grid{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}@media(min-width:600px){.wishlist-page__grid{grid-template-columns:repeat(3,1fr);gap:20px}}@media(min-width:1024px){.wishlist-page__grid{grid-template-columns:repeat(5,1fr);gap:24px}}.wishlist-grid-item{position:relative;box-shadow:0 0 39px #b5b5b547;border-radius:8px;overflow:hidden;padding:13px;background-color:#fff;transition:opacity .3s ease,transform .3s ease,box-shadow .3s ease}.wishlist-grid-item:hover{box-shadow:0 4px 24px #0000001f;transform:translateY(-2px)}.wishlist-grid-item .card__quick-add{position:static;transform:none;opacity:1;pointer-events:initial;padding:8px 0 0}.wishlist-grid-item.is-removing{opacity:0;transform:translate(20px)}.wishlist-grid-item__remove{position:absolute;top:13px;right:13px;width:36px;height:36px;display:flex;align-items:center;justify-content:center;border:none;border-radius:50%;background:#ffffffe6;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);cursor:pointer;color:#1a1a1a;transition:background-color .2s ease,color .2s ease;z-index:12;padding:0}.wishlist-grid-item__remove:hover{background:#e53e3e;color:#fff}.wishlist-grid-item__remove svg{width:20px;height:20px;pointer-events:none}.wishlist-empty{text-align:center;padding:80px 20px}.wishlist-empty__icon{width:64px;height:64px;margin:0 auto 20px;color:rgba(var(--text-color),.2)}.wishlist-empty__heading{font-size:1.3em;margin:0 0 8px}.wishlist-empty__text{color:rgba(var(--text-color),.6);margin:0 0 24px}.wishlist-empty__link{display:inline-block;padding:12px 28px;background:rgb(var(--btn-bg-color));color:rgb(var(--btn-text-color));text-decoration:none;border-radius:var(--btn-border-radius, 4px);font-weight:600;transition:background-color .2s ease;text-transform:var(--btn-text-transform, none)}.wishlist-empty__link:hover{background:rgb(var(--btn-bg-hover-color))}.wishlist-skeleton{display:grid;grid-template-columns:repeat(2,1fr);gap:16px}@media(min-width:600px){.wishlist-skeleton{grid-template-columns:repeat(3,1fr);gap:20px}}@media(min-width:1024px){.wishlist-skeleton{grid-template-columns:repeat(5,1fr);gap:24px}}.wishlist-skeleton__card{border-radius:8px;overflow:hidden}.wishlist-skeleton__image{aspect-ratio:1;background:rgba(var(--text-color),.06);animation:wishlist-pulse 1.5s ease-in-out infinite}.wishlist-skeleton__text{padding:12px}.wishlist-skeleton__line{height:12px;border-radius:4px;background:rgba(var(--text-color),.08);margin-bottom:8px;animation:wishlist-pulse 1.5s ease-in-out infinite}.wishlist-skeleton__line:nth-child(2){width:60%}.wishlist-skeleton__line:nth-child(3){width:40%;margin-bottom:12px}.wishlist-skeleton__line:last-child{height:36px;width:100%}@keyframes wishlist-pulse{0%,to{opacity:1}50%{opacity:.4}}.wishlist-toast{position:fixed;bottom:24px;left:50%;transform:translate(-50%) translateY(100px);padding:12px 20px;background:#1a1a1a;color:#fff;border-radius:8px;font-size:.85em;z-index:200;opacity:0;transition:transform .3s ease,opacity .3s ease;pointer-events:none;white-space:nowrap}.wishlist-toast.is-visible{transform:translate(-50%) translateY(0);opacity:1}.wishlist-share{position:relative}.wishlist-share__trigger{background:#f6f2ea!important;color:#1c3405!important;border:1px solid #1c3405!important;border-radius:30px!important;padding:8px 18px!important;font-size:14px!important;font-weight:600!important;display:inline-flex!important;align-items:center;gap:8px;cursor:pointer;transition:background-color .15s ease}.wishlist-share__trigger:hover{background:#ede8de!important}.wishlist-share__dropdown{position:absolute;top:calc(100% + 6px);right:0;background:#fff;border:1px solid rgba(0,0,0,.1);border-radius:8px;box-shadow:0 4px 16px #0000001a;padding:6px 0;min-width:180px;z-index:20}.wishlist-share__option{display:flex;align-items:center;gap:10px;padding:10px 16px;color:#1c3405;text-decoration:none;font-size:14px;font-weight:500;border:none;background:none;width:100%;cursor:pointer;transition:background-color .15s ease}.wishlist-share__option:hover{background:#f6f2ea}
/*# sourceMappingURL=/cdn/shop/t/17/assets/wishlist.css.map */
